Backtesting Your Automated Trading Strategies

Before deploying any automated trading strategy into the real market, it's crucial to rigorously backtest its results. Backtesting involves simulating your strategy on previous market data to gauge how it would have operated in different trading conditions. This process allows you to highlight potential strengths and optimize your strategy before risking capital.

  • Consider various periods for your backtesting.
  • Harness a comprehensive set of market data to ensure reliability.
  • Document your results and interpret them critically.

Dive into Algorithmic Trading: A Beginner's Guide

Embarking on the journey of algorithmic trading can feel overwhelming at first. Nevertheless, with a solid understanding of the fundamentals and the right tools, you can successfully navigate this exciting field. Start by learning about key trading terms like market orders, limit orders, and stop-loss orders. ,After that, delve into various algorithmic trading strategies, such as trend following, mean reversion, and breakout trading. Remember to start small, deploy your algorithms with a paper trading account before risking real capital. Continuous learning and fine-tuning are crucial for success in this dynamic market.

  • Research different programming languages commonly used in algorithmic trading, such as Python or R.
  • Test your strategies on historical data to evaluate their performance.
  • Join online communities and forums to learn from experienced traders and stay updated on the latest trends.

Risk Management in Algorithmic Trading

One of the paramount challenges in algorithmic trading is effectively managing risk. These systems, while potentially highly profitable, can also be susceptible to sudden market movements. A well-defined risk management framework is crucial to mitigating potential losses and preserving capital. This typically involves establishing strategies such as stop-loss orders, proactively observing portfolio performance, and conducting comprehensive simulations of trading algorithms before implementation in live markets.

Lightning-Quick Trading: Agility and Effectiveness

High-frequency trading (HFT) centers around the ability to execute trades at an incredible rate. Advanced programs are implemented to identify fleeting market shifts, allowing traders to profit from even the tiniest price adjustments. This speed is crucial for HFT's success, as it allows participants to surpass competitors and maximize their returns.

  • However, the high speed of HFT can also poseconcerns for market stability.
  • Supervisory bodies are constantly working to balance the benefits and risks of this evolving trading strategy.

Identifying Profitable Trading Patterns with Algorithms

Algorithmic trading has revolutionized the financial markets, enabling traders to scrutinize vast amounts of data and identify profitable trading patterns. By constructing sophisticated algorithms, traders can streamline their trading strategies and boost their profits. These algorithms process historical price fluctuations, market indicators, and news data to produce buy and sell signals. Profitable trading patterns often manifest as recurring structures in price graphs. Algorithms can recognize these patterns with exactness, providing traders with a tactical edge.

  • For instance technical indicators such as moving averages, Bollinger Bands, and MACD can be incorporated into algorithms to identify potential buy and sell signals.
  • Moreover, machine learning algorithms can adapt from historical data to anticipate future price movements.

Constructing a Custom Automated Trading Platform

Venturing into the realm of automated trading requires a deep understanding of financial markets and programming. Building your own custom platform presents an opportunity to tailor your strategies and gain granular control over your investments. This process can be complex, requiring expertise in areas such as algorithmic trading, data analysis, risk management, and software development. Start by outlining your trading goals and the type of assets you intend to trade. Then, select a suitable programming language and framework to build your platform. Leverage existing libraries and APIs to streamline the integration with market data sources and order execution systems. Thoroughly test your algorithms in simulated environments before deploying them with real capital. Continuously monitor and refine your system based on results and market conditions.
